#ifndef AVUTIL_FLOAT_DSP_H
 | 
						|
#define AVUTIL_FLOAT_DSP_H
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#include "config.h"
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
typedef struct AVFloatDSPContext {
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Calculate the product of two vectors of floats and store the result in
 | 
						|
     * a vector of floats.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param dst  output v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src0 first input v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src1 second input v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param len  number of elements in the input
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: multiple of 16
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    void (*vector_fmul)(float *dst, const float *src0, const float *src1,
 | 
						|
                        int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Multiply a vector of floats by a scalar float and add to
 | 
						|
     * destination vector.  Source and destination vectors must
 | 
						|
     * overlap exactly or not at all.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param dst result v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src input v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param mul scalar value
 | 
						|
     * @param len length of v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: multiple of 16
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    void (*vector_fmac_scalar)(float *dst, const float *src, float mul,
 | 
						|
                               int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Multiply a vector of floats by a scalar float.  Source and
 | 
						|
     * destination vectors must overlap exactly or not at all.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param dst result v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src input v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param mul scalar value
 | 
						|
     * @param len length of v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: multiple of 4
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    void (*vector_fmul_scalar)(float *dst, const float *src, float mul,
 | 
						|
                               int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Multiply a vector of double by a scalar double.  Source and
 | 
						|
     * destination vectors must overlap exactly or not at all.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param dst result v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src input v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param mul scalar value
 | 
						|
     * @param len length of vector
 | 
						|
     *            constraints: multiple of 8
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    void (*vector_dmul_scalar)(double *dst, const double *src, double mul,
 | 
						|
                               int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Overlap/add with window function.
 | 
						|
     * Used primarily by MDCT-based audio codecs.
 | 
						|
     * Source and destination vectors must overlap exactly or not at all.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param dst  result v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src0 first source v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src1 second source v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param win  half-window v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param len  length of v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: multiple of 4
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    void (*vector_fmul_window)(float *dst, const float *src0,
 | 
						|
                               const float *src1, const float *win, int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Calculate the product of two vectors of floats, add a third vector of
 | 
						|
     * floats and store the result in a vector of floats.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param dst  output v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src0 first input v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src1 second input v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src2 third input v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param len  number of elements in the input
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: multiple of 16
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    void (*vector_fmul_add)(float *dst, const float *src0, const float *src1,
 | 
						|
                            const float *src2, int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Calculate the product of two vectors of floats, and store the result
 | 
						|
     * in a vector of floats. The second vector of floats is iterated over
 | 
						|
     * in reverse order.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param dst  output v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src0 first input v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param src1 second input vector
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: 32-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param len  number of elements in the input
 | 
						|
     *             constraints: multiple of 16
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    void (*vector_fmul_reverse)(float *dst, const float *src0,
 | 
						|
                                const float *src1, int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Calculate the sum and difference of two vectors of floats.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param v1  first input vector, sum output, 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param v2  second input vector, difference output, 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param len length of vectors, multiple of 4
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    void (*butterflies_float)(float *restrict v1, float *restrict v2, int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    /**
 | 
						|
     * Calculate the scalar product of two vectors of floats.
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@param v1  first vector, 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param v2  second vector, 16-byte aligned
 | 
						|
     * @param len length of vectors, multiple of 4
 | 
						|
     *
 | 
						|
     * @return sum of elementwise products
 | 
						|
     */
 | 
						|
    float (*scalarproduct_float)(const float *v1, const float *v2, int len);
 | 
						|
} AVFloatDSPContext;

/**
 | 
						|
 * Return the scalar product of two vectors.
 | 
						|
 *
 | 
						|
 * @param v1  first input vector
 | 
						|
 * @param v2  first input vector
 | 
						|
 * @param len number of elements
 | 
						|
 *
 | 
						|
 * @return sum of elementwise products
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
float avpriv_scalarproduct_float_c(const float *v1, const float *v2, int len);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
/**
 | 
						|
 * Initialize a float DSP context.
 | 
						|
 *
 | 
						|
 * @param fdsp    float DSP context
 | 
						|
 * @param strict  setting to non-zero avoids using functions which may not be IEEE-754 compliant
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
void avpriv_float_dsp_init(AVFloatDSPContext *fdsp, int strict);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
void ff_float_dsp_init_aarch64(AVFloatDSPContext *fdsp);
 | 
						|
void ff_float_dsp_init_arm(AVFloatDSPContext *fdsp);
 | 
						|
void ff_float_dsp_init_ppc(AVFloatDSPContext *fdsp, int strict);
 | 
						|
void ff_float_dsp_init_x86(AVFloatDSPContext *fdsp);
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#endif /* AVUTIL_FLOAT_DSP_H */
